Cedar Roof Replacement Cost Range in Schenectady, NY
Typical low-high price ranges for cedar roof replacement vary based on project scope and roof size. The following provides an overview of common cost estimates for different project types.
$8,000 - $15,000: Basic residential replacement with standard cedar shakes
$15,000 - $25,000: Larger or premium installations with additional features
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Residential Replacement |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Premium Residential Replacement | $15,000 - $25,000 |
| Small Commercial Building | $12,000 - $20,000 |
| Large Commercial or Multi-Unit | $25,000 - $40,000 |
| Re-roofing with Repairs |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| New Cedar Roof on New Construction | $10,000 - $18,000 |
What Affects the Cost of Cedar Roof Replacement
Understanding the factors that influence the cost of cedar roof replacement can help homeowners in Schenectady, NY, make informed decisions. Several elements can impact the overall project expenses, including materials, scope, and additional requirements.
- Materials: The quality and type of cedar wood chosen, such as Western Red Cedar or Eastern White Cedar, can affect costs.
- Size and Scope: The total square footage and complexity of the roof design influence the amount of materials and labor needed.
- Labor Complexity: Roofs with multiple levels, intricate features, or difficult access may require more specialized labor, impacting costs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Schenectady may require permits, which can add to project expenses and timeline.
- Extras: Additional features such as ventilation systems, flashing, or weatherproofing can contribute to overall costs.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small (e.g., 1,000 sq ft) | $8,000 - $12,000 |
| Medium (e.g., 1,500 sq ft) | $12,000 - $18,000 |
| Large (e.g., 2,000 sq ft) | $18,000 - $24,000 |
| Extra Large (e.g., 2,500+ sq ft) | $24,000 - $30,000+ |
In Schenectady, NY, project costs may vary based on local labor rates and material availability.
